Working towards residence in New Zealand

Image showing a business meeting.
Working temporarily in New Zealand can be used as a step towards gaining residence and settling here permanently.

If your talents are needed by New Zealand employers, or you have exceptional talent in the arts, culture or sports, you can apply to work in New Zealand under our Work to Residence category.

After you are accepted

If you are already in New Zealand on a Work to Residence permit, after two years you can apply for residence.
